PAWS Adoption Center PAWS is a no-kill, non-profit animal shelter in Monroe, Ohio. We house approximately 80 dogs & cats.
(320)

Adoption costs include spay/neuter, vaccinations, health tests, and microchip. Dogs - 6 months and younger - $225, over 6 months - $200
Cats - $100

‼️This animal is not currently at the shelter‼️ This post is to assist in the rehoming of an animal so they don’t have to spend a day in the shelter. If you or someone you know can provide a loving and safe home for the pup, please reach out to (609)731-9643

Hi, I’m Milo! I am a 9-year-old Carolina dog. While I am an older guy, I have a big puppy heart! My owner sadly passed away, and I’ve been hoping to find a new family to love. I have arthritis in my back legs, but I still enjoy walks, car rides, meeting new people and dogs, tug of war, and doing my zoomies. I can’t jump up to excitedly greet people anymore, so I stand next to them and wait for pets—and with your permission, I’ll still try to sneak into your lap.

I used to live in a house with a fenced yard, and I loved sunbathing, exploring, and watching squirrels. I’d be happiest in a home with a fenced-in yard again, or at least more space and people or dogs around to keep me company.

I’m house-trained, crate-trained, and know my basic commands. I walk pretty well, but I sometimes pull toward dogs or squirrels, and I get nervous around new people on walks. I use a front-clip harness and shock-absorbing leash to help.

I’m neutered, up-to-date on my shots, on flea/tick prevention, allergic to chicken, and take arthritis meds twice a day plus joint supplements. I can’t jump like I used to, so I may need a little help getting onto things.

I hope I can find a home with love, space, and comfort again.

Please reach out to (609)731-9643 with any questions or interest in this sweet boy.

Meet Kai — an oversized sweetheart with endless love and smiles to share 💕🐾

Kai is a 1 year old, 65 pound pointer mix who’s equal parts goofy, loving, and full of life. This big guy has tons of energy and enjoys walks, adventures, and stretching out those long legs every chance he gets. He does great with kids, cats, and other dogs, and while his playstyle can be a bit rough with other dogs, it makes him an awesome match for pups who love to wrestle and romp.

He’s still working on his manners, but he’s very trainable and especially motivated when treats are involved! His beautiful ticked coat is unbelievably soft and so pretty in person, and those puppy eyes he gives when he just wants love will grab anyone’s attention instantly. Most of his excitement comes from wanting to be close to you, preferably sneaking in a hug whenever he can.

If you’re searching for a fun, loyal, affectionate, and trainable companion, Kai might be the perfect fit. Call (513) 539-7297 to schedule a time to meet him! 💙🐾
